I was able to do this earlier this year by removing the rear center headrest so I would have room to work, loosening the headliner at the center of the rear window and reaching in with a cresent wrench set by the nut on the replacement antenna. The only fun I had was getting the nut started on the new antenna and figuring out how the connector worked. Assuming you also have a Jetta sedan and that your arms aren't too much bigger than mine I suspect you can pull this off the same way. I was surprised by how much better my AM reception was once I replaced the antenna, so my amplifier must have been dead for quite a while.
